
The Philippine Basketball Association, also known as PBA, is a Philippine professional basketball league. The rules and regulations followed in the said league are a combination of rules from the National Basketball Association widely known as NBA and the International Basketball Federation or the FIBA. Founded in 1975, It is the first and oldest professional basketball league in the Asia.
Founded as a rebellion of teams from the Manila Industrial and Commercial Athletic Association, the Philippine Basketball Association had its first season that opened in April 9, 1975. In its first season, 9 teams from the MICAA participated. These teams were the Mariwasa-Noritake, Crispa, Toyota, Concepcion Carrier, Royal Tru-Orange, CFC, 7-Up, Tanduay and U-Tex.
During the league's first ten years, many great rivalries were born. Considered the greatest rivalry, the Crispa Redmanizers and the Toyota Tamaraws had big names playing for them. Some of these great players are Robert Jaworski, Ramon Fernandez, Francis Arnaiz, Atoy Co, Bogs Adornado, and Philip Cezar.
Since 1990, the Philippine Basketball Association started to send its all-pro squads to the Asian Games.
The national team, headed by Chot Reyes, began to be active in the year 2005. The national team is composed of selected players from the Philippine Basketball Association and is called the Philippine National Basketball Team or "Team Pilipinas".
During 1975-2003, every season was composed of three conferences or tournaments. These were called All Filipino, Commissioner's and Governors Cups that usually had a format of best-of-7. The winner takes the Conference Cup. Regarding these tournaments, if a team wins all of the conferences, they are said to be the Grand Slam champion.
In 2004, Noli Eala, the sixth commissioner of the Philippine Basketball Association from 2003 to 2007, made drastic changes to the time the season was held. This change was due to the schedule of the international tournaments. They moved the season calendar as to accomodate the said international tournaments, usually held from June to September. The number of conferences was reduced from three to two and are held from February to October.
These new tournaments are the Philippine Cup and the Fiesta Conference. The former is held from October to February. In this Cup, only locals are allowed to play. The latter is held from March to June. In this conference, teams are allowed one foreign player called an "import". The Rookie Draft is held every August.
Every team is owned by a company and is not geographically based. The team's name often has three parts which are the company name, the product and a nickname. This team name changes only if the franchise is sold to another subsidiary.

Sonny Barrios is the seventh and current commissioner of the Philippine Basketball Association.
